Transaction 31aae19e79fc22b6e0654cf61760d07160f532fa9bd8a07d95a3600b3e3b7a60

1 Input
2 Outputs
  • 31aae19e79fc22b6e0654cf61760d07160f532fa9bd8a07d95a3600b3e3b7a60:0
  • value  108418796
    address  39REDArENU8oKYPwrjv8LRqKNBV4vQijWx
  • 31aae19e79fc22b6e0654cf61760d07160f532fa9bd8a07d95a3600b3e3b7a60:1
  • value  969561
    address  38URrgiaA8UG2XjnfKoZFsEjTtpfSh6ZqH